D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ION

Motion by the respondents to dismiss an appeal from an order of the Supreme Court, Kings County, dated May 16, 2006, on the ground that the order denied a motion which was, in effect, for leave to reargue.

Upon the papers filed in support of the motion and the papers filed in opposition thereto, it is

ORDERED that the motion is denied without prejudice to raising the issue in the respondents' brief.
